如何在WebLogic服务器中配置多数据源以支持故障转移和负载均衡?
时间: 2024-11-08 16:26:04 浏览: 14
在WebLogic服务器中配置多数据源,实现故障转移和负载均衡是提升企业级应用稳定性和性能的关键步骤。《WebLogic创建多数据源教程》能为你提供详尽的配置指导和最佳实践。
参考资源链接:[WebLogic创建多数据源教程](https://wenku.csdn.net/doc/5e1ryx8uhx?spm=1055.2569.3001.10343)
首先,需要明确的是,WebLogic中的数据源配置涉及到数据源的创建、连接池的管理以及故障转移和负载均衡的策略设置。以下是详细步骤:
1. 登录WebLogic管理控制台,并选择要配置数据源的特定域。
2. 进入数据源配置页面,创建两个或多个单数据源。按照教程中提供的步骤,输入正确的数据库连接信息,包括数据库类型、地址、端口、用户名和密码。
3. 对于每个单数据源,设置合适的连接池参数。例如,设置最小、最大和目标连接数,以及连接超时和验证查询等参数,以满足应用程序的需求。
4. 配置好单数据源后,创建一个多数据源,并将其配置为故障转移或负载均衡模式。
5. 在多数据源配置中,添加之前创建的单数据源作为成员,确保它们的JNDI名称与多数据源配置中的逻辑名称一致。
6. 根据需要选择适合的数据源模式,如非XA或XA,以及相应的事务管理策略,这将影响事务的提交和回滚。
7. 完成配置后,测试多数据源以确保其按照预期工作。进行故障转移和负载均衡测试,确保在单数据源出现故障或高负载情况下,多数据源能够正确接管并处理请求。
完成以上配置后,WebLogic将会根据设置的策略自动管理和切换数据源,从而提供持续的高可用性和高效的负载处理能力。在实际操作中,理解连接池参数的含义和作用是至关重要的,这有助于优化数据库连接的使用,提升整体应用性能。
为了深入理解并掌握WebLogic多数据源的配置和管理,建议详细阅读《WebLogic创建多数据源教程》。这份资料不仅涵盖了基础的创建和配置步骤,还包括了高级的配置选项和性能优化建议,是WebLogic管理员不可或缺的参考资料。
参考资源链接:[WebLogic创建多数据源教程](https://wenku.csdn.net/doc/5e1ryx8uhx?spm=1055.2569.3001.10343)
阅读全文